Stress And Anxiety and Weight Gain: The Link



Really feeling worried not only affects your psychological wellness however additionally plays a substantial function in triggering weight gain. When stress and anxiety ends up being a continuous friend, it can lead to unhealthy consuming habits. Oftentimes, people turn to high-calorie comfort foods as a coping mechanism, seeking short-term relief from their stress factors. This can lead to taking in a lot more calories than your body actually requires, leading to weight gain gradually.

Additionally, anxiety activates the launch of cortisol, also called the anxiety hormonal agent, in your body. Elevated cortisol degrees can raise your appetite, particularly for sugary and fatty foods. This hormonal feedback makes it more difficult to stand up to junk food choices, better adding to weight gain.

In addition, persistent stress and anxiety can disrupt your sleep patterns, which consequently affects your body's hunger hormonal agents. When you don't obtain sufficient peaceful rest, your hunger-regulating hormonal agents can become unbalanced, bring about enhanced food cravings and over-eating. For that reason, handling anxiety is critical not only for your mental wellness but additionally for preserving a healthy weight.

Impacts of Stress on Metabolism



Tension affects your metabolic rate by triggering the release of cortisol, a hormone that can influence exactly how your body procedures and stores energy. When you experience tension, cortisol levels climb, signifying your body to launch glucose into the bloodstream to provide a fast resource of power for the fight-or-flight action. This rise in sugar can bring about boosted insulin degrees, which may cause lower blood sugar degrees afterwards, causing desires for sweet or fatty foods to restore the energy shed during the stress and anxiety feedback.

Moreover, cortisol can likewise influence how your body shops fat, especially targeting natural fat around the abdominal area. High levels of cortisol can increase the storage of fat in this field, which is linked to a higher danger of wellness issues like heart disease and diabetic issues. In addition, stress-induced cortisol release can reduce your metabolic process in time, making it tougher to melt calories successfully and potentially causing weight gain. Recognizing these effects can aid you create strategies to handle stress and support a much healthier metabolic rate.

Battling Stress-Induced Weight Gain



To reduce the effect of stress-induced weight gain, implementing healthy lifestyle routines can be extremely effective. Exercise not just helps shed calories however likewise lowers tension degrees and improves overall well-being. Go for at the very least 30 minutes of moderate exercise most days of the week.

Furthermore, concentrate on consuming a well balanced diet plan abundant in fruits, vegetables, lean healthy proteins, and whole grains. Stay clear of turning to comfort foods high in sugar and undesirable fats when stressed, as these can contribute to weight gain.



Technique mindfulness and stress-reducing strategies such as reflection, deep breathing, or yoga exercise to aid take care of stress and anxiety levels effectively. Appropriate sleep is additionally vital in dealing with stress-induced weight gain, as lack of rest can disrupt appetite hormones and result in overeating. Prioritize obtaining 7-9 hours of quality sleep each evening.
